I started scrapbooking when my daughter was about 4 and my son was 6, so 20 years ago. I love creating with paper and creating memories. I let the photos lead me to papers and embellishments. I love using sketches and watching tutorials online for inspiration. I love trying new techniques.
My scrapbook style is mostly clean. I tend to use one or just a couple photos, add ink splatters, layer paper, add buttons, sequins, string or thread, and ripped paper edges. I tend to use the same type of embellishment over and over until I notice something that I have not used in a while and then use that all the time.
Right now, my top three embellishments that I am using are: thread or string, gems, and buttons
